Benchmarking in 4K Video Editing
When tested with popular 4K video editing software such as Adobe Premiere Pro and DaVinci Resolve, the Arc A580 demonstrated remarkable performance. Rendering times were significantly reduced compared to previous generation cards, enabling faster project completion.
- Rendering Speed: Up to 30% faster than comparable GPUs in 4K timelines.
- Playback Performance: Smooth real-time playback without dropped frames.
- Encoding Capabilities: Supports hardware acceleration for H.264 and H.265 codecs.
Test Results Summary
In benchmark tests, the Arc A580 completed complex 4K exports approximately 25-30% faster than its predecessor, reducing editing and rendering times significantly. Its ability to handle high-bitrate footage with ease makes it an ideal choice for professional editors.
Performance in 3D Rendering Tasks
3D artists and animators rely heavily on GPU power for rendering detailed models and scenes. The Arc A580’s performance was evaluated using industry-standard benchmarks such as Blender and Autodesk Arnold.
- Rendering Speed: Achieved up to 40% faster render times in complex scenes.
- Real-Time Viewport: Smooth navigation and manipulation of high-poly models.
- Ray Tracing: Enhanced support for real-time ray tracing effects.
Benchmark Highlights
In tests with Blender’s Cycles renderer, the Arc A580 consistently outperformed comparable GPUs, especially in scenes with intricate lighting and textures. Its hardware-accelerated ray tracing capabilities contributed to more realistic visuals with less lag.
